Tax handling considerations

For international B2B, don’t evaluate only the ecommerce platform. You’ll usually need integrations for:

  • VAT/GST/sales tax calculation
  • Tax exemptions by customer type
  • Import duties and landed cost
  • Regional invoicing requirements
  • Tax registrations

Common integrations include:

  • Avalara
  • Vertex
  • TaxJar

Platforms such as Spree explicitly support tax integrations and regional tax configuration. Spree Commerce

A key distinction: Shopify Managed Markets is strongest for cross-border international selling, whereas if you're operating separate legal entities in many countries with country-specific VAT/GST registration, invoicing, accounting, and ERP requirements, I'd treat the commerce platform as only one part of the architecture. You may still want an external tax engine and ERP/local accounting integrations.

My recommendation: start with Shopify Plus + Markets, and add a dedicated tax engine only if your tax complexity exceeds what Shopify's native/Managed Markets capabilities cover. Capabilities I would require before choosing

For your use case, make sure the platform supports:

  • Multi-currency
    • fixed prices by currency (not only exchange-rate conversion)
    • currency rounding rules
    • customer-specific currencies
  • Localized catalogs
    • country-level product availability
    • regional SKUs
    • translated attributes/specifications
    • different images/content per market
  • B2B pricing
    • account-based pricing
    • contract pricing
    • volume discounts
    • negotiated quotes
    • customer groups
  • Tax compliance
    • VAT/GST/sales tax rules
    • tax-exempt customers
    • reverse charge handling
    • integrations with services such as Avalara or Vertex
  • Operations
    • regional warehouses
    • multi-country inventory
    • localized payment methods
    • ERP/CRM integration

One important caveat: “tax handling” can mean very different things—basic tax calculation versus VAT/GST registration, exemptions, tax-inclusive pricing, invoicing, fiscalization, and multi-entity compliance.
